Devereux Pa Adult Services PCH Hirest Cottage is an assisted living community located in Berwyn, PA. This board and care home provides a range of care services and amenities to ensure the comfort and well-being of its residents.
The community offers fully furnished accommodations with housekeeping services to maintain a clean and comfortable living environment. Residents can enjoy the indoor common areas and the small library for leisure activities. There is also a beauty salon on-site for residents to pamper themselves.
Meals are provided in the dining room with restaurant-style dining, and special dietary restrictions such as diabetes diet are accommodated. The community also offers medication management and assistance with activities of daily living, including bathing, dressing, and transfers.
Residents have access to outdoor spaces such as gardens for relaxation or socializing with other residents. Wi-Fi/high-speed internet is available throughout the community for staying connected with friends and family.
Various activities are scheduled daily, including community-sponsored activities, devotional activities offsite, and resident-run activities. Additionally, there are 7 cafes, 2 parks, 13 pharmacies, 4 physicians' offices, 11 restaurants, 3 transportation options, 1 theater nearby for convenience and entertainment.
Devereux Pa Adult Services PCH Hirest Cottage ensures 24-hour supervision and provides ambulatory care to meet the unique needs of each resident. Assisted living facilities offer crucial support for older adults needing help with daily activities but come with varying and significant costs, which can be financed through personal savings, government assistance programs, long-term care insurance, and home equity options. Professional guidance from experts can aid families in navigating these financial complexities to establish a sustainable budgeting approach for assisted living services.

Assisted living costs often exceed Social Security benefits, necessitating a combination of funding sources like state aid and Medicaid. Understanding the interaction between Social Security programs and available financial support is essential for affording such care.
